Transaction 7076e33fd4c63a16971ac10a852ecc99a0cd22d51505dee1ab6069a4769af58e

3 Input
2 Outputs
  • 7076e33fd4c63a16971ac10a852ecc99a0cd22d51505dee1ab6069a4769af58e:0
  • value  1000000
    address  3K9pDYy5D8tCBZgZMsK1NLF8ron2B28rrc
  • 7076e33fd4c63a16971ac10a852ecc99a0cd22d51505dee1ab6069a4769af58e:1
  • value  25306003
    address  3PijNPp22xFdsPuKJgCknujeZUgVgeWciW